The Advantages of Triggered Emails

Emails are typically utilized for push marketing and are a one-to-many message. Within the industry, this is fondly known as batch and blast. The timing is up to the sender. Triggered email differs, combining a custom template and user data to send an email message when a specific event occurs. The event triggers the email. Triggered emails are sent directly through backend system or using an email service provider typically through an API integration.

Some marketing automation systems like our client, Right On Interactive, offer opportunities to design an entire sequence of triggered messaging to lead folks back to your site. While triggered message campaigns are often highly customized and complex, the benefits are quite substantial. Since they typically occur due to an event – they can be sent with pinpoint timing and accuracy to reach the person at the right time, with the right message, at the right moment. This means improvements in conversion rates and improved customer experiences.
